From the LA Times:

On Sunday night, several Florida newspapers and a pro football-related Internet site reported that a plane registered to Dolphins owner Wayne Huizenga flew to Costa Rica, where Carroll has been vacationing, and that team representatives are believed to have met with USC's coach. The plane was used for the team's previous coaching interviews.

The Dolphins are seeking a successor to Nick Saban, who quit last week to become coach at Alabama.

Carroll could not be reached for comment.

Carroll, who has guided the Trojans to a 59-6 record and two national championships in the last five seasons, has been connected with NFL coaching vacancies after nearly every one of his six seasons at USC.
